As 2012 reaches its conclusion, remember what one big showbiz name said this time last year? Andrew Lloyd Webber claimed London theatre would be ‘a bloodbath’ during the Olympics. So was the Golden Summer in Stratford matched with success in the West End? LBC 97.3′s Joe Pike investigates…
